On May 20, Goertek, in collaboration with Qualcomm Technologies, Inc., announced a new wireless AR smart glasses reference design based on the Snapdragon® XR2 platform, aiming to help OEMs and brand manufacturers bring AR products powered by Snapdragon XR2 to market more quickly.
Following the launch of its wired AR glasses reference design based on the Snapdragon® XR1 platform last year, Goertek’s latest AR glasses reference design supports a wide range of use cases, including office productivity, gaming and entertainment, task guidance, remote assistance, education, and simulation training.
Compared with the previous generation, the new AR smart glasses offer several significant improvements. The device can connect directly to smartphones or PCs via Wi-Fi 6/6E and Bluetooth, enabling a fully wireless experience. It adopts an upgraded ultra-lightweight freeform optical solution, reducing the thickness of the front frame by nearly 40%. A balanced weight distribution between the front and back of the glasses helps minimize pressure and enhances wearing comfort. In addition, Goertek has, for the first time, incorporated high-strength carbon fiber into the glasses’ temples, improving durability while allowing for a thinner design.
Goertek and Qualcomm Technologies began collaborating in the XR field in 2015. Leveraging the powerful computing capabilities of Snapdragon platforms, Goertek combines its expertise in acoustics, optics, sensors, advanced materials, and system integration to create cutting-edge VR/AR reference designs for the industry. Through these innovations, the company aims to accelerate the commercialization and widespread adoption of XR products.
